Chemistry

Charles Hatchett's work on chemistry occurred mostly between 1796 and 1806, a ten-year period. In 1796, he published "An analysis of the Corinthian molybdate of lead", resolving a dispute over the nature of the mineral. In 1797 he was elected a Fellow of The Royal Society, largely as a result of this work. In more than 20 additional papers, he addressed the chemistry of
minerals In geology and mineralogy, a mineral or mineral species is, broadly speaking, a solid chemical compound with a fairly well-defined chemical composition and a specific crystal structure that occurs naturally in pure form.John P. Rafferty, ed ...
,
resins In polymer chemistry and materials science, resin is a solid or highly viscous substance of plant or synthetic origin that is typically convertible into polymers. Resins are usually mixtures of organic compounds. This article focuses on natu ...
and
natural products A natural product is a natural compound or substance produced by a living organism—that is, found in nature. In the broadest sense, natural products include any substance produced by life. Natural products can also be prepared by chemical sy ...
. In 1800 Hatchett may have opened a small chemical works at Chiswick in London. In 1798, Hatchett was asked by members of the Privy Council to work with
Henry Cavendish Henry Cavendish ( ; 10 October 1731 – 24 February 1810) was an English natural philosopher and scientist who was an important experimental and theoretical chemist and physicist. He is noted for his discovery of hydrogen, which he termed "infl ...
and assess "the state of the coins of the realm" to ensure that they were not being adulterated. He produced a 152-page-long report in 1803. He concluded that 'there was no important defect in the composition or quantity of the standard gold'. Hatchett developed a collection of over 7000 minerals, which he sold to the
British Museum The British Museum is a public museum dedicated to human history, art and culture located in the Bloomsbury area of London. Its permanent collection of eight million works is among the largest and most comprehensive in existence. It docum ...
in London in 1799. He agreed to organize the museum's mineral collection, but retained the right to remove and analyze portions of some of the specimens. In 1801, Hatchett analyzed a piece of
columbite Columbite, also called niobite, niobite-tantalite and columbate [], is a black mineral group that is an ore of niobium. It has a submetallic Lustre (mineralogy), luster and a high density and is a niobate of iron and manganese. This mineral group ...
from the collection at the British Museum. Columbite turned out to be a very complex mineral, and Hachett discovered that it contained a "new earth" which implied the existence of a new element. Lavoisier had defined the term "element" a mere 13 years previously. Hatchett called this new element "columbium" (Cb) in honour of
Christopher Columbus Christopher Columbus * lij, Cristoffa C(or)ombo * es, link=no, Cristóbal Colón * pt, Cristóvão Colombo * ca, Cristòfor (or ) * la, Christophorus Columbus. (; born between 25 August and 31 October 1451, died 20 May 1506) was a ...
, the discoverer of America. On 26 November of that year he announced his discovery before the
Royal Society The Royal Society, formally The Royal Society of London for Improving Natural Knowledge, is a learned society and the United Kingdom's national academy of sciences. The society fulfils a number of roles: promoting science and its benefits, re ...
. In 1802
Anders Gustaf Ekeberg Anders Gustaf Ekeberg ( Stockholm, Sweden, 16 January 1767 – Uppsala, Sweden, 11 February 1813) was a Swedish analytical chemist who discovered tantalum in 1802. - subscription required He was notably deaf. Education Anders Gustav Ekeberg ...
(1767–1813) announced the discovery of another new element, "tantalum". For many years, there was confusion over whether columbium and tantalum were the same. In 1846, German chemist
Heinrich Rose Heinrich Rose (6 August 1795 – 27 January 1864) was a German mineralogist and analytical chemist. He was the brother of the mineralogist Gustav Rose and a son of Valentin Rose. Rose's early works on phosphorescence were noted in the Quarte ...
argued that there were two additional elements in tantalite, which he named niobium and pelopium for the children of the Cyclops. Eventually, Rose's niobium (atomic number 41) was found to be identical to Hatchett's columbium. In 1949, the name ''niobium'' was chosen for element 41 at the 15th Conference of the Union of Chemistry in Amsterdam.

Later life

After his father's death, Hatchett largely gave up his activities as a chemist. He inherited his father's coach-making business and pursued interests in collecting books, manuscripts, paintings, and musical instruments. His loss was lamented by colleagues such as
Thomas Thomson Thomas Thomson may refer to: * Tom Thomson (1877–1917), Canadian painter * Thomas Thomson (apothecary) (died 1572), Scottish apothecary * Thomas Thomson (advocate) (1768–1852), Scottish lawyer * Thomas Thomson (botanist) (1817–1878), Scottis ...
(1773–1852), who wrote that Hatchett "was an active chemist…but unfortunately this most amiable and accomplished man has been lost to science for more than a quarter of a century; the baneful effects of wealth, and cares of a lucrative and extensive business, having completely waned him from scientific pursuits". Hatchett lived at
Mount Clare, Roehampton Mount Clare is a Grade I listed house built in 1772 in Minstead Gardens, Roehampton, in the London Borough of Wandsworth. The architect was Sir Robert Taylor, and the house was enlarged with a portico and other enrichments in 1780 by Placid ...
from 1807 to 1819. It has been described as "a little estate built in a fine Italian style" with nearby "a very well-equipped laboratory". The house was designed by Sir Robert Taylor for George Clive, with modifications by the Italian architect Placido Columbani in 1780. The gardens were laid out by Capability Brown in 1774. In 1818 Hatchett either bought back or chose to no longer lease out the house that had been built by his father in 1771, Belle Vue, 92 Cheyne Walk, in
Chelsea, London Chelsea is an affluent area in west London, England, due south-west of Charing Cross by approximately 2.5 miles. It lies on the north bank of the River Thames and for postal purposes is part of the south-western postal area. Chelsea histori ...
. A grade II
listed building In the United Kingdom, a listed building or listed structure is one that has been placed on one of the four statutory lists maintained by Historic England in England, Historic Environment Scotland in Scotland, in Wales, and the Northern Irel ...
, it has a large central portion with bay windows back and front, and two wings. It overlooks gardens and the
River Thames The River Thames ( ), known alternatively in parts as the River Isis, is a river that flows through southern England including London. At , it is the longest river entirely in England and the second-longest in the United Kingdom, after the R ...
. He lived there for the rest of his life. Elizabeth, his wife, predeceased him in 1837. Hatchett himself died at Belle Vue House in 1847, and is buried at St Laurence's Church, Upton-cum-Chalvey, Slough, the same church where his friend
William Herschel Frederick William Herschel (; german: Friedrich Wilhelm Herschel; 15 November 1738 – 25 August 1822) was a German-born British astronomer and composer. He frequently collaborated with his younger sister and fellow astronomer Caroline ...
is interred.


Recognition

Hatchett was awarded the Copley Medal by the
Royal Society The Royal Society, formally The Royal Society of London for Improving Natural Knowledge, is a learned society and the United Kingdom's national academy of sciences. The society fulfils a number of roles: promoting science and its benefits, re ...
in 1798. In 1828, he was recognized by the Royal Institution. Hatchett,
Humphry Davy Sir Humphry Davy, 1st Baronet, (17 December 177829 May 1829) was a British chemist and inventor who invented the Davy lamp and a very early form of arc lamp. He is also remembered for isolating, by using electricity, several elements for t ...
, William Thomas Brande,
William Hyde Wollaston William Hyde Wollaston (; 6 August 1766 – 22 December 1828) was an English chemist and physicist who is famous for discovering the chemical elements palladium and rhodium. He also developed a way to process platinum ore into malleable ingot ...
,
Michael Faraday Michael Faraday (; 22 September 1791 – 25 August 1867) was an English scientist who contributed to the study of electromagnetism and electrochemistry. His main discoveries include the principles underlying electromagnetic inducti ...
and
John Frederic Daniell John Frederic Daniell FRS (12 March 1790 – 13 March 1845) was an English chemist and physicist. Biography Daniell was born in London. In 1831 he became the first professor of chemistry at the newly founded King's College London; and in 18 ...
received a gold medal for their discoveries in chemistry. The award was given by John Fuller, founder of the Institution's Fullerian Chair of Chemistry. In 1979, the Companhia Brasileira de Metalurgia e Mineração established the Charles Hatchett Award. It is presented by the Institute of Materials, Minerals and Mining ("IOM3") (London), yearly, to a noted metallurgist. The award is given for "the best research on the science and technology of niobium and its alloys". The medal is cast in pure niobium.
